import { MonitorConnectionContext } from "./monitor_connection_context";
import { HostInfo } from "../../host_info";
import { AwsWrapperError } from "../../utils/errors";
import { Monitor, MonitorImpl } from "./monitor";
import { WrapperProperties } from "../../wrapper_property";
import { PluginService } from "../../plugin_service";
import { Messages } from "../../utils/messages";
import { TelemetryCounter } from "../../utils/telemetry/telemetry_counter";
import { TelemetryFactory } from "../../utils/telemetry/telemetry_factory";
import { ClientWrapper } from "../../client_wrapper";
import { logger } from "../../../logutils";
import { SlidingExpirationCacheWithCleanupTask } from "../../utils/sliding_expiration_cache_with_cleanup_task";
export interface MonitorService {
startMonitoring(
clientToAbort: ClientWrapper,
hostInfo: HostInfo,
properties: Map<string, any>,
failureDetectionTimeMillis: number,
failureDetectionIntervalMillis: number,
failureDetectionCount: number
): Promise<MonitorConnectionContext>;
/**
* Stop monitoring for a connection represented by the given {@link MonitorConnectionContext}.
* Removes the context from the {@link MonitorImpl}.
*
* @param context The {@link MonitorConnectionContext} representing a connection.
* @param clientToAbort A reference to the connection associated with this context that will be aborted.
*/
stopMonitoring(context: MonitorConnectionContext, clientToAbort: ClientWrapper): Promise<void>;
releaseResources(): Promise<void>;
}
export class MonitorServiceImpl implements MonitorService {
private static readonly CACHE_CLEANUP_NANOS = BigInt(60_000_000_000);
protected static readonly monitors: SlidingExpirationCacheWithCleanupTask<string, Monitor> = new SlidingExpirationCacheWithCleanupTask(
MonitorServiceImpl.CACHE_CLEANUP_NANOS,
(monitor: Monitor) => monitor.canDispose(),
async (monitor: Monitor) => {
{
try {
await monitor.releaseResources();
} catch (error) {
// ignore
}
}
},
"efm2/MonitorServiceImpl.monitors"
);
private readonly pluginService: PluginService;
private telemetryFactory: TelemetryFactory;
private readonly abortedConnectionsCounter: TelemetryCounter;
monitorSupplier = (
pluginService: PluginService,
hostInfo: HostInfo,
properties: Map<string, any>,
failureDetectionTimeMillis: number,
failureDetectionIntervalMillis: number,
failureDetectionCount: number,
abortedConnectionsCounter: TelemetryCounter
) =>
new MonitorImpl(
pluginService,
hostInfo,
properties,
failureDetectionTimeMillis,
failureDetectionIntervalMillis,
failureDetectionCount,
abortedConnectionsCounter
);
constructor(pluginService: PluginService) {
this.pluginService = pluginService;
this.telemetryFactory = pluginService.getTelemetryFactory();
this.abortedConnectionsCounter = this.telemetryFactory.createCounter("efm2.connections.aborted");
}
async startMonitoring(
clientToAbort: ClientWrapper,
hostInfo: HostInfo,
properties: Map<string, any>,
failureDetectionTimeMillis: number,
failureDetectionIntervalMillis: number,
failureDetectionCount: number
): Promise<MonitorConnectionContext> {
const monitor = await this.getMonitor(hostInfo, properties, failureDetectionTimeMillis, failureDetectionIntervalMillis, failureDetectionCount);
if (monitor) {
const context = new MonitorConnectionContext(clientToAbort);
monitor.startMonitoring(context);
return context;
}
throw new AwsWrapperError(Messages.get("MonitorService.startMonitoringNullMonitor", hostInfo.host));
}
async stopMonitoring(context: MonitorConnectionContext, clientToAbort: ClientWrapper): Promise<void> {
context.setInactive();
if (context.shouldAbort()) {
try {
await clientToAbort.abort();
this.abortedConnectionsCounter.inc();
} catch (error) {
// ignore
logger.debug(Messages.get("MonitorConnectionContext.errorAbortingConnection", error.message));
}
}
}
async getMonitor(
hostInfo: HostInfo,
properties: Map<string, any>,
failureDetectionTimeMillis: number,
failureDetectionIntervalMillis: number,
failureDetectionCount: number
): Promise<Monitor | null> {
const monitorKey: string = `${failureDetectionTimeMillis.toString()} ${failureDetectionIntervalMillis.toString()} ${failureDetectionCount.toString()} ${hostInfo.host}`;
const cacheExpirationNanos = BigInt(WrapperProperties.MONITOR_DISPOSAL_TIME_MS.get(properties) * 1_000_000);
return MonitorServiceImpl.monitors.computeIfAbsent(
monitorKey,
() =>
this.monitorSupplier(
this.pluginService,
hostInfo,
properties,
failureDetectionTimeMillis,
failureDetectionIntervalMillis,
failureDetectionCount,
this.abortedConnectionsCounter
),
cacheExpirationNanos
);
}
async releaseResources() {
await MonitorServiceImpl.monitors.clear();
}
}
